Some further thoughts on Stormhaven and the world of N’Ume. The map that I’m using was created using the Azgaar Fantasy Map Generator. Here is the overview I have currently have regarding the geography and history of N’Ume.

1. All the stories take place on the continent of Damunger. It is about the size of Europe. The Arten Commonwealth is roughly the size of Germany I think, with a climate that varies between something similar to Southern Portugal in the South to the Highlands of Scotland in Narshadow. There are four other continents on N’Ume but they are unknown and not currently part of the Chronicles.

2. If a town or city is noted on the map it indicates a population of 10,000 to 500,000 inhabitants. Stormhaven has a population approaching 400,000 while Azdar City approaches 500,000. Such cities are few and are state or regional capitals

3. Most of the population of the Adzar Empire and the Arten Commonwealth and Narshadow do not live in large towns but in smaller agricultural towns, villages and hamlets with populations under 10,000. These town and villages can be found along the roads connecting larger towns but are not marked on the continental map unless they have particular significance.

4. There is a good network of major roads marked on the map. The network of roads in Adzar and Arten (once part of the Empire) began creation under the reign of the first Adzar Emperor, Marius Cuso and became known as Cuso’s Gift. Similarly a system of aqueducts in the Arten Commonwealth became known as Ulf’s gift after the Paladin Ulf Pendragon a century ago. It is said that Euen Mistborn spends much time on the building of Stormhaven sewerage system because he want to be remembered for it as Mistborn’s Gift. Euen of course denies this ambition saying that all he wants to do is to serve Stormhaven and the Commonwealth.

5. The level of technological development evident in Azdar City and Stormhaven is similar to that of Europe’s Renaissance period with Azdar City and Stormhaven matching Mediterranian trading cities such as Venice. Complementing technologies depending on known laws of physics there are also magical technologies that will be addressed elsewhere. In addition to human invention there is considerable influence on development through the Dwarakai (Dwarf and Gnome) community in Stormhaven. The Adzar Empire is known to be using guns and gunpower but they have not yet arrived at the stage reached in Europe during the English Civil War.

6. Although the human (Manakai) population of Azdar and Arten resembles Earth’s European populations and are referred to as ‘Renlai’ (meaning white-skinned) there are significant non-Renlai humans in both nations. Stormhaven is particularly multicultural having been captured and held by the darker skinned Gharissans and Durdessans (similar to Earths Middle Eastern to African populations) in the times before Ulf established the Commonwealth. During the time of Ulf Pendragon an alliance was established with Durdessa and Durdessan or Durdessan descended feature prominently among Stormhaven’s Warrior and Mage classes.

7. The non-Manakai population of Stormhaven features small but significant Dwarakai and Orakai communities. The terms Manakai, Dwarakai, Elvakai and Orakai were invented as part of Ulf pendragon’s idealism – outside of the Commonwealth and in its provinces more distant from Stormhaven and the T’Ever Corridor the terms Dwarf, Gnome, Orc, Goblin and Elf are still common. The word ‘Kai’ refers to the the quality of mind shared sentient/sapient. It is a term of respect. An alternative to Kai covering Manakai, Elvakai, Orakai and Dwarakai, is N’Uman (meaning man or person of N’Ume).
